开通会员
  • 尊享所有功能
  • 文件大小最高200M
  • 文件无水印
  • 尊贵VIP身份
  • VIP专属服务
  • 历史记录保存30天云存储
开通会员
您的位置:首页 > 帮助中心 > js预览pdf的插件_使用JS预览PDF插件的技巧
默认会员免费送
帮助中心 >

js预览pdf的插件_使用JS预览PDF插件的技巧

2024-12-11 05:34:36
js预览pdf的插件_使用js预览pdf插件的技巧
《javascript pdf预览插件:便捷的文档预览解决方案》

在web开发中,经常需要实现pdf文件的预览功能。javascript的pdf预览插件应运而生。

这些插件具有诸多优势。首先,它们提供了跨浏览器的兼容性,确保在不同的浏览器环境下都能稳定运行。例如,pdf.js是一款流行的开源插件,它能够将pdf文件渲染为html5元素,直接在网页上展示。

使用这些插件时,开发人员只需简单引入相关库文件,通过少量的代码就能实现pdf的加载和预览。这不仅节省了开发时间,还提升了用户体验。无论是文档管理系统,还是在线教育平台,javascript的pdf预览插件都为高效展示pdf内容提供了可靠的途径。

js pdf预览插件

js pdf预览插件
# 《js pdf预览插件:便捷的文档预览解决方案》

在现代web开发中,pdf预览是一项常见需求。javascript的pdf预览插件为此提供了极大便利。

这些插件通常易于集成到网页中。它们能够快速加载pdf文件,在浏览器端实现无缝预览。例如,pdf.js是一款流行的开源插件,它利用html5技术,无需额外的pdf阅读器即可显示pdf内容。用户可以轻松地进行页面导航、缩放等操作。

使用js pdf预览插件,能提升用户体验。无论是在文档管理系统,还是在线教育平台展示资料等场景,都能高效地将pdf展示给用户,并且确保跨浏览器的兼容性,为开发人员节省大量开发时间,是实现pdf预览功能的理想选择。

js实现pdf预览

js实现pdf预览
js实现pdf预览

在javascript中,实现pdf预览有多种方式。一种常见的方法是使用pdf.js库。首先,需要引入pdf.js库文件。

然后,可以通过javascript代码获取pdf文件的url或本地路径。利用pdf.js提供的功能来加载并渲染pdf文档。例如,可以创建一个``元素,pdf.js会将pdf的页面绘制到这个画布上。

代码示例:
```javascript
var url = 'example.pdf';
pdfjs.getdocument(url).promise.then(function(pdf) {
pdf.getpage(1).then(function(page) {
var canvas = document.createelement('canvas');
var context = canvas.getcontext('2d');
var viewport = page.getviewport({ scale: 1.0 });
canvas.width = viewport.width;
canvas.height = viewport.height;
page.render({ canvascontext: context, viewport: viewport });
document.body.appendchild(canvas);
});
});
```
这样就能在网页上实现简单的pdf预览功能了。

viewer.js pdf

viewer.js pdf
《viewer.js:便捷的pdf查看解决方案》

viewer.js是一款非常实用的用于查看pdf文件的javascript库。

在网页应用中,它发挥着重要作用。它能够轻松地将pdf文件嵌入到网页里,提供流畅的查看体验。不需要额外的pdf阅读器插件,用户就可以直接在浏览器中查看pdf文档。viewer.js界面简洁直观,用户可以方便地进行页面缩放、翻页等操作。对于开发人员来说,集成viewer.js到项目中也相对容易,大大节省了开发处理pdf查看功能的时间和精力。无论是在线文档管理系统,还是教育类网站分享学习资料,viewer.js都是一个不错的选择,提升了pdf文件在网页端查看的便捷性与高效性。
您已连续签到 0 天,当前积分:0
  • 第1天
    积分+10
  • 第2天
    积分+10
  • 第3天
    积分+10
  • 第4天
    积分+10
  • 第5天
    积分+10
  • 第6天
    积分+10
  • 第7天

    连续签到7天

    获得积分+10

获得10积分

明天签到可得10积分

咨询客服

扫描二维码,添加客服微信